Brian Leishman vs Lee Anderson

A side-by-side comparison of voting participation, party rebellion, topic focus, and recent voting overlap.


Voting alignment

Brian Leishman and Lee Anderson voted the same way 8% of the time, based on 268 shared comparable votes.

22 same votes 246 different votes 268 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
